*Title*: *Using Envoy XDS TTL causes envoy to crash*

*Description*:
Hi,
I was just playing around to get an idea of what’s possible with XDSTTL. My config, in all recent versions (1.23->1.25), crashes Envoy when a ttl is reached (apparently). Though I only have the stack for 1.25 (full log attached).

Caught Segmentation fault, suspect faulting address 0x0
Backtrace (use tools/stack_decode.py to get line numbers):
Envoy version: d362e791eb9e4efa8d87f6d878740e72dc8330ac/1.18.2/clean-getenvoy-76c310e-envoy/RELEASE/BoringSSL
#0: __restore_rt [0x7f1e64aea420]->[0x29700fe2d420] ??:0
#1: std::__1::__function::__func<>::operator()() [0x55ae568e53bd]->[0x1c283bd] ??:?
#2: event_process_active_single_queue [0x55ae56c085b7]->[0x1f4b5b7] snapshot.cc:?
#3: event_base_loop [0x55ae56c0720e]->[0x1f4a20e] snapshot.cc:?
#4: Envoy::Server::InstanceImpl::run() [0x55ae5653d7e8]->[0x18807e8] ??:?
#5: Envoy::MainCommonBase::run() [0x55ae54cbe9c4]->[0x19c4] ??:0
#6: Envoy::MainCommon::main() [0x55ae54cbf2e6]->[0x22e6] ??:0
#7: main [0x55ae54cbd13c]->[0x13c] ??:0
#8: __libc_start_main [0x7f1e64908083]->[0x29700fc4b083] ??:0

The test harness is nothing special, though I do presume there’s user error in my usage of ttl.….but it shouldn’t be crashing. I’m just using the go control plane and setting the ResourceWithTTL with static ttls for the test:
https://github.com/bladedancer/xds-test/blob/ttl/pkg/xds/worker.go#L164
